About PCED

Established on May 13, 1974, the Philippine Center for Economic Development (PCED), through Presidential Decree (PD) No. 453,  was tasked with the key role of providing financial and moral support to the research, teaching, training, and other programs of the UP School of Economics (UPSE). This enables the UPSE to carry out its academic functions on a broader scale via the PCED while preserving a significant level of autonomy. The emphasis remains on faculty initiative as the primary avenue for fostering proficient training and research.

Advancing Researchers and Policy Makers: 2025 Training on Impact Evaluation

The Philippine Center for Economic Development (PCED) and the UP School of Economics (UPSE) are organizing the 2025 Training on Impact Evaluation for Research, Projects and Policies. This initiative is part of PCED’s and UPSE’s public service commitment to provide quality and relevant trainings to their stakeholders. The training will be conducted on June 30-July 25, 2025 at UPSE.
